On Tue, Oct 06, 1998 at 10:28:25PM +0200, Kurt Garloff wrote:
> Hi there,
> 
> if you got an AM53C974 based PCI SCSI host adapter, e.g. Tekram DC390(T) or
> DawiControl 2974, then please test my latest driver: dc390-120t3
> You can find it on 
> ftp://student.physik.uni-dortmund.de/pub/linux/kernel/dc390/

A bug has been found and fixed. I you met 
DC390: DataIn_0: DAM timed out. 0 bytes remain.
then you should upgrade to 1.20t4.

Driver is on its usual place.

Still looking forward to seeing more test results.
